Vaddio Expands RoboSHOT Camera Lineup with New RoboSHOT 12 HDMI and RoboSHOT 30 HDMI

Vaddio has added two new cameras to the RoboSHOT series, the RoboSHOT 12 HDMI and RoboSHOT 30 HDMI. Both feature HDMI out, Ethernet for IP control, a better image signal processor (ISP) and Vaddio’s Tri-Synchronous Motion.
